Monthly Cost of Living

Monthly costs for one person with rent: $2,156 in Aalst versus $1,028 in Medellin.

Estimated couple costs with rent: $3,151 in Aalst versus $1,586 in Medellin.

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$4,146 in Aalst versus $2,144 in Medellin.

Living in Aalst is roughly 110% more expensive than in Medellin, driven mainly by Eating Out.

The two cities straddle the global median: Aalst is 62% above, Medellin is 23% below.

Cost Breakdown

A one-bedroom apartment in the center runs $970 in Aalst and $485 in Medellin. Housing cost is often the main lever when comparing two cities.

Aalst pays 390% more on average. The extra income cushions the higher costs, though housing choices and lifestyle decide how much of the gap is truly closed.

Dining out: $104 in Aalst vs $33.00 in Medellin for a mid-range dinner for two. Groceries echo the gap at $350 vs $190 per month, with Medellin cheaper across the board.
